The fellowship is a two-year postdoctoral fellowship position in the research group of Dr. Irep Gözen at the Centre for Molecular Medicine Norway (NCMM); Department of Medicine, University of Oslo.The aim of this project is manipulation and characterization of surface-adhered biological membranes to understand the material-driven aspects of cellular processes.
Location of study: Oslo university, Norway.
Fellowship Type: Full-time contract
Faculty of study: Medicine
Level of study: PhD
Salary: The postdoctoral position will be placed as SKO 1352 (position code) postdoctoral research fellow with salary NOK 486 100 – 567 100 per year – depending on qualifications
Eligibility:
- The fellow must possess the following qualifications:
- Completed Ph.D. degree in biophysics, biophysical chemistry or material science.
- Experience with biological samples/cell culturing
- Practical knowledge of microfabrication procedures/clean room experience
- Working knowledge of image analysis (Matlab, Python or similar) Preferably: completed programming education during undergraduate studies
- Practical knowledge of optics is an advantage
- Ability to independently perform experiments, analyze and interpret the results
- Documented ability to write scientific manuscripts, first author papers from Ph.D. studies (multiple is advantageous)
- Excellent interpersonal/communication skills
- Advanced level English in reading, writing, and speaking
